The father of the Ohio teen who was killed when his doped-up girlfriend smashed her car into a building at 100 miles per hour said he doesn’t want to see his son’s killer spend the rest of her life behind bars.

Frank Russo, 61, said his son Dominic’s death wouldn’t be meaningfully avenged by a life sentence ruling for 19-year-old Mackenzie Shirilla, who was convicted of murder Monday after prosecutors said she deliberately plowed her car into the brick warehouse.
